切花菊悬浮细胞系的建立及生长规律
Establishment of Cell Suspension Culture and Growth Regularity of Dendrathema morifolium

摘要
以切花菊‘粉贵人’(Dendrathema morifolium‘ Fenguiren’)淡黄色、质地疏松、增殖速度快的愈伤组织为起始材料,接种在MS+2,4-D0.5 mg/L+6-BA0.2 mg/L+30 g/L蔗糖的液体培养基上,在23℃黑暗条件下振荡(100 r/min)培养30 ~40 d,建立分散性好、均匀、生长迅速的悬浮细胞系.在悬浮细胞系培养过程中研究了悬浮细胞的生长规律,结果表明:在40 mL培养液中,接种细胞起始数量最适为1.6×103 ~4.8×103个;pH值范围在5.29~5.68时,悬浮细胞增殖率最高,继代时保留1/3体积的旧培养液有利于其细胞增殖.
Abstract
Dendrathema morifolium ' Fenguiren' of pale yellow callus with loose structure and high proliferation rate was selected as material for cell suspension culture.It was cultured in modified liquid MS medium MS+2,4-D0.5 mg/L+6-BA0.2 mg/L+30 g/L, and shook at 100 r/min under dark condition at 23 ℃.About 30-40 days later, stably growing cell suspension cultures were established.The growth pattern of the cultures was investigated.The results showed there are 1.6× 103-4.8×103 initial inoculation cells in the liquid medium of 40 mL.In 5.29-5.68 of pH, suspension cell has the highest rate of cell proliferation.1/3 of old liquid medium left is fit for cell proliferation during subculture.
